2011-06-19 15 views
0

iPadではWebページをスクロールできません。 OS XのSafari、Chrome、Firefoxでうまく動作します。iPadでWebページをスクロールできない

このページには、コンテンツが水平方向にのみスクロールできる領域があります。幅= 100%、高さ=(100%〜40px)のコンテナdivで構成されています。私はウィンドウのサイズ変更イベントによってトリガされるJavaScipt関数によって高さを設定しています。このコンテナの内側には、内容の幅を持つ別のdiv(改行を避けるために非常に幅広)があります。その中にコンテンツがあります。コンテナの

CSSプロパティは次のとおりです。

overflow-x:scroll; 
overflow-y:hidden; 
white-space:nowrap; 

はこちらのページと完全なソースコードを参照してください:iPadでdcfoto.de

を、スクロールすることはできません。私は間違って何をしていますか? ところで、向きを変更すると、サイズ変更も正しく動作しません。多分それはつながっています。

+1

参照:http://stackoverflow.com/questions/3845445/how-to-get-the-scroll-bar-with-css-overflow-on-ios – BGerrissen

答えて

1

残念なことに、2本指のスワイプを実行する必要があります。また、デフォルトの1本の指スワイプのスクロールと比較して応答しません。

は、そこ(煎茶タッチとiscroll最も有望であり、かつ高度)

私はそこにクールなタッチスクロールスクリプトダウンの手ですhttp://cubiq.org/iscroll-4をお勧めします、非常に多くのjavascriptのソリューションがあります。それはアンドロイドでも機能しますが、デフォルトのアンドロイドブラウザはWebkitベースのものではなく、モバイルSafariのようなcss3の3dアクセラレーションをサポートしています。

私があなたの場合は、ユーザーのユーザーエージェントを確認し、アンドロイドとipad/iphoneユーザー用のスクリプトを展開します。

関連する問題